Alongside O'Gara in the Ireland backline will be the now familiar Conor Murray, Keith Earls operating in the unfamiliar number 15 jersey and Simon Zebo who pulls on the Ireland senior jersey for the first time.
Mike Sherry also makes his senior debut in this non-cap game with Donncha Ryan at lock and Peter O'Mahony achoring the Irish scrum.
There's a long overdue inclusion for James Coughlan in the match day squad, the Dolphin clubman will hopefully get to play his first game since breaking a bone in his hand in the Heineken Cup quarter final clash with Ulster.
Ireland: K Earls; C Gilroy, D Cave, P Wallace, S Zebo; R O’Gara (capt), C Murray; B Wilkinson, M Sherry, D Fitzpatrick; D Tuohy, D Ryan; J Muldoon, C Henry, P O’Mahony. Replacements: R Best, R Loughney, D O’Callaghan, J Coughlan, P Marshall, N Spence, A Trimble.
Barbarians: C Heymans; P Sackey, M Tindall, D Traille, S Tagicakibau; F Contepomi, R Lawson; D Jones, B August, J Afoa; M O’Driscoll (capt), C Van Zyl; M Gorgodze, F Louw, R Lakafia. Replacements: A de Malmanche, N Tialata, P Taele, A Qera, R Rees, S Donald, I Nacewa.
